Guerlain Lingerie de Peau Foundation comes in a sleek glass bottle with black lid. The lid had the Guerlain logo printed on the top in Gold. It has a black pump dispenser. The packaging looks gorgeous and classy. It is not really travel-friendly beinga glass bottle, but it definitely hygienic and looks good on the vanity. This is a pricey foundation and I feel like packaging adds to the luxury feeling!
The Guerlain Inivisble Skin-Fusion foundation comes in a variety of shades and I was color matched to the shade 03 Beige Natural. The foundation is a thin runny consistency and it is really easy to apply with fingers of a brush. I usually like dotting it all over my face and then blending it with a brush. Guerlain Lingerie De Peau Foundation has a light to light-medium coverage and it sets to a satin finish. I really like how it looks on the skin! It does not enlarge pores and does not settle into fine lines. It does fit onto the skin like a dream and looks very natural. I have gotten a lot of compliments whenever I have worn this foundation.
It does not oxidize to a darker shade, a problem I have faced with a few foundations in the past. I like that it has SPF and PA contained in it. I like to protect my skin from the harsh rays of the sun so with a broad spectrum sunscreen underneath this foundation, and I am set!
This foundation lasts upto 7-8 hours on me with minimal fading. It looks gorgeous even after hours and photographs well, even in flash. The scent, though pleasant, is quite strong and totally unnecessary. There are plenty of silicones in the packaging so they counteract the alcohols contained in this foundation. So it is not heavy or even drying to the skin. If you are allergic to silicone or fragrance, then skip this foundation else it is an awesome (pricey) light to light-medium coverage, satin finish foundation!
It does not feel heavy like a foundation, I feel that it is lighter than many BB creams in the market. It did not break me out at all. I think this foundation will work really well for normal to oily skintones. I had a few issues with my dry skin peeking through in winter when I used this foundation, It works well for me in summer!

Overall I am pleased with the Guerlain Lingerie de Peau foundation. It comes in a variety of shades, has a hygienic pump packaging and looks gorgeous on the skin. It looks really good in photos, even in flash. It stays all through the day and requires minimal touch ups. It also contains medium protection broad spectrum sunscreen. It is a pricey product but if you are looking to indulge, this foundation is worth every penny it costs. I love how it looks on me. I do plan to repurchasing it in the future!
